The ÐÓ°Épro Cooperative Extension Service will host 14 free community workshops May 19–23 on the UAF campus.
The one-hour evening workshops will cover energy solutions for living off the grid, household pests, food preservation, adaptations for aging in your home, heating with firewood, using biomass, wind and solar power, radon detection and more.
Instructors from Extension and the ÐÓ°Épro Center for Energy and Power will teach the workshops in Room 201 of the Reichardt Building. See the full schedule at . For more information, call Carmen Kloepfer at 474-5854.
